Problem-Solving Skills Graphs for children ages 4-9 are essential tools for parents and teachers, as they provide invaluable insights into a child's cognitive development. During these formative years, children are rapidly developing critical thinking and decision-making abilities. Monitoring problem-solving skills can help identify areas where a child is excelling or may need additional support.
Graphs visually represent a child's progress over time, making it easier to spot trends and patterns. For example, a child who consistently struggles with specific types of problems might benefit from personalized activities or educational games that target those areas. Conversely, a child showing advanced skills in certain areas might be ready for more challenging tasks, thus fostering continued intellectual growth.
Additionally, these graphs serve as a communication tool between parents and teachers. Regular updates can help both parties collaborate effectively, ensuring that the child receives consistent support at home and in the classroom. They also empower parents to take an active role in their child's education, facilitating exercises that enhance problem-solving skills through everyday activities.
Overall, investing time in understanding and utilizing Problem-Solving Skills Graphs can contribute significantly to a child's academic success and overall development, setting the groundwork for a lifelong ability to tackle challenges creatively and efficiently.
